Yinka Kolawole in Osogbo

Weeks after Osun State Governor, Ademola Adeleke, sacked three monarchs in the state, Prince Ibraheem Oyelakin has emerged as the Oba-elect after a selection process.

Governor Adeleke had sacked Owa of Igbajo, Oba Adegboyega Famodun; Are of Iree, Oba Ademola Ponle, and Akirun of Ikirun, Oba Yinusa Akadiri, after faulting their selection process. He also ordered a fresh process to nominate new kings. Later, Oyelakin from Oyekun Ruling House emerged as the Oba-elect for Iree community in Boripe Local Government Area.

A statement issued by the Oba-elect praised his co-contestants and sought their support.

He said: “I will never take this privilege for granted. I commend the Iwarefa mefa of Iree kingdom, Aree in council, princes and princesses, Asiwaju of Iree, IPA National president, among others for their support.

“The rain we pray for is here, and the good news we pray for is here. We all need to bury our past either full of differences, calamities or fairy tales.” 

“The bond that strengthens us is stronger than the differences that almost consumed us. Iree kingdom is known for relative peace as we all know. Let us revisit the history and bring back the memory of a peaceful coexistence we used to enjoy.”
